How they compare
Spain currently reports 4.8% against 4.7% in Hungary,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 20 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Hungary ahead.
Hungary ranks 30th and Spain ranks 29th of 42 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Hungary averaged higher in 2 and Spain in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Hungary | Spain |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 5.3% | 4.6% | 0.7% | Hungary |
| 2000s | 5.3% | 4.4% | 0.9% | Hungary |
| 2010s | 4.8% | 4.9% | 0.1% | Spain |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
